The present work proposes a methodology for the evaluation of the hydrodynamic loads endured in the event of aircraft ditching. The determination of the hydrodynamic loads on the full aircraft is necessary to substantiate the aircraft dynamics and structural integrity during ditching. In this context, the semi-analytical method called MLM (Modified Logvinovich Model) presents the advantage of estimating general hydrodynamic loads at reduced computational costs. After depicting the proposed methodology, we compare experimental water impact results to simulation results obtained with our industrial calculation tool ELFINI®. Finally, the extension to full aircraft studies is discussed.
